Service account: telemetry-compactor. This account runs the Briskmere pipeline stage that compresses telemetry payloads with zstd (level 7) before forwarding to cold storage in the Vellwick cluster. Do not lower the compression level without a capacity review, as downstream quotas assume the current ratio. Rotation happens quarterly. The account authenticates to the internal compaction API with the key that follows.

service key, fawip-bajef: kto11_Qt5wZK9vdNC

Escalation: static-analysis baseline file (Quarrow scanner). If the baseline drifts — new findings suppressed without review, or CI failing on previously-accepted entries — do not regenerate it locally. Revert to the last reviewed version, open a ticket tagged baseline-drift, and page the tooling rotation if release-blocking. Baseline edits require two approvals. Unresolved after one business day? Escalate to the appsec leads at the address below.

billing contact of bahop-tahag = quenix.istax@paliqworks.corp

## Kiosk Watchdog — Quick Runbook

Welcome aboard! The Marrowfield kiosks run a watchdog called Perchkeeper that restarts the display app if it stops heartbeating for 90 seconds. If a kiosk is boot-looping, the watchdog is usually fighting a corrupted cache — clear it from the service menu before blaming hardware. When you file a report, include the kiosk's firmware token, shown below.

build token for yajof-bajof: htk31_506ff1188f74596b5bb2eec94edc43c

/*
 * TUMBLEKEY_GRACE_WINDOW controls how long a laundry-locker
 * door stays unlockable after a pickup code is verified in the
 * Tumblekey app. New folks: do not shorten this below 45 seconds;
 * field testing in the Marrow Street pilot showed users need time
 * to walk from the kiosk to their assigned locker. Changes here
 * require sign-off and must reference the build noted below.
 */

trace token, fafog-kageg: htk4_98e6